Part (a): Largest 3-digit number
To make the largest number, we want the
biggest digits in the highest place values.
The hundreds place should be the biggest digit available →
7
Then tens place → next biggest →
6
Then units place → next biggest →
4
So:
764
Check: Is there any bigger combination?
Try 762 → smaller than 764
746 → smaller
726 → smaller
674 → smaller
... yes, 764 is the largest.
Now write it in words:
Seven hundred and sixty-four

Part (b): Smallest 3-digit number
To make the smallest number, we want the
smallest digits in the highest place values, BUT — the first digit (hundreds place) cannot be zero. In this case, we don’t have zero, so no problem.
Smallest digit for hundreds place →
2
Next smallest for tens →
4
Next smallest for units →
6
So:
246
Check other combinations:
247 → bigger
264 → bigger
426 → bigger
... yes, 246 is the smallest.
Write it in words:
Two hundred and forty-six
